Athens, the capital city of Greece, is one of the most historically significant cities in the world. With its rich cultural heritage, stunning ancient ruins, and vibrant modern life, Athens continues to captivate visitors from around the globe. This city, known as the cradle of Western civilization, has been the birthplace of many philosophical, political, and artistic movements that have shaped the modern world.
A Glimpse into Athens' Ancient History The history of Athens stretches back over 3, 400 years, with its roots deeply intertwined with Ancient Greece. It was in Athens that some of the most influential philosophers and thinkers of all time, including Socrates, Plato, and Aristotle, laid the foundation for modern philosophy. The city is also the birthplace of democracy, with the Athenian democracy serving as a model for the democratic systems we know today. One of the most iconic landmarks in Athens is the Acropolis, a UNESCO World Heritage Site that has stood for centuries as a symbol of ancient Greek architecture and culture. Dominating the city's skyline, the Parthenon, a temple dedicated to the goddess Athena, is a testament to the grandeur and artistic achievements of the ancient Greeks. Visitors to Athens can explore these ancient wonders and imagine the grandeur of the city in its prime. Athens Today: A Blend of Old and New While Athens is steeped in ancient history, it is also a vibrant, modern metropolis. The city has undergone significant transformation in recent years, blending its classical heritage with contemporary urban life. The Plaka neighborhood, for example, is a charming area with narrow cobblestone streets, traditional Greek tavernas, and souvenir shops, while modern districts such as Syntagma Square and Kolonaki offer bustling shops, cafes, and nightlife. Athens is also home to an array of world-class museums and galleries. The National Archaeological Museum and the Acropolis Museum are must-visit destinations for anyone interested in learning more about the ancient history of Athens and its remarkable contributions to art and culture. The Benaki Museum and Byzantine Museum showcase the city's more recent history, with impressive collections from the Byzantine and Ottoman periods. A Culinary Journey Through Athens Greek cuisine is another highlight of a visit to Athens. From fresh seafood to delicious pastries, Athens offers a wide variety of mouthwatering dishes. Don’t miss trying a traditional Greek salad, moussaka, or a delicious serving of souvlaki. For dessert, a piece of baklava or loukoumades (Greek honey doughnuts) is the perfect way to end a meal. The city’s food scene also embraces modern trends, with numerous innovative restaurants and cafes offering contemporary twists on traditional Greek flavors. Whether you're dining at a trendy rooftop restaurant with views of the Acropolis or enjoying a meal in a cozy local taverna, Athens’ culinary scene is sure to impress. Athens: Gateway to the Greek Islands One of the greatest advantages of staying in Athens is its proximity to some of the most stunning Greek islands in the Aegean and Ionian Seas. From Athens, travelers can easily embark on a day trip or a longer stay to islands such as Santorini, Mykonos, Hydra, and Spetses. These islands are renowned for their breathtaking landscapes, pristine beaches, and vibrant local cultures, making Athens the perfect gateway to the idyllic Greek islands.
